The village is named after Saint Baglan, the earliest known reference is to `Bagelan` and dates as far back as 1199. Baglan is located on the side of a steep hill and is surrounded by two main hills, MynyddyGaer (to the north) and Mynydd Dinas (to the east). Baglan has a large residential community along with an active and busy industrial estate and also has many other amenities such as local shops and businesses and its own railway station which is served by Arriva Trains Wales. UNDERAGE YOUTHS DRINKING ALCOHOL BY BAGLAN LIBRARY
Youths are drinking alcohol infront of Baglan Library mainly on weekends after 9pm. The youths are leaving their rubbish outside the library and are then being abusive towards passers by.
